SHIRLEY WHELCHEL
PONTOTOC — Services for Shirley Whelchel, 62, Pontotoc, are 2 p.m. Thursday at the Criswell Funeral Home Chapel, the Rev. Glen Thomason will officiate. Burial will follow at Pontotoc Cemetery.

Mrs. Whelchel died Monday, March 28, 2005, at an Oklahoma City hospital. She was born May 21, 1942, in Compton, Calif., to Elmer and Gladys Cullison Doyel. She attended school at Tishomingo.

She married Joe M. Whelchel Aug. 18, 1958, in Pontotoc.

Mrs. Whelchel was a clerk in a drug store and restaurant, most recently, she was employed with home healthcare. She was a member of the Church of God of Prophecy in Wapanucka, and active in church music ministry.

Survivors include her husband, Joe Whelchel, of the home; a daughter, Dawn Tadlock and her husband Earnest, Ada; grandchildren, Michelle Pearce, Ada and Christopher Pearce, Pontotoc; one brother, Billy Doyel, Bakersfield, Calif.; her mother-in-law, Viola Whelchel, Ada; five sisters-in-law and two brothers-in-law.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Elmer and Gladys Doyel, a daughter, Kay Lynn Flowers in 2002, a sister, Norma Allen and a brother, Tommy Doyel.

Bearers will be Frank Wallace, Darrel Horath, Roy Taylor, Jack McFeeters, Quinton Overstreet and George Moore. Honorary bearers are Roger Sullenger and Duane Allen.

Criswell Funeral Home, Ada

FRANK DOYLE
ALLEN — Services for Frank Doyle, 67, Allen, are 2 p.m. Friday at Richmond Avenue Free Will Baptist Church, the Rev. Buddy Drake will officiate. Burial will follow at Allen Cemetery. Chickasaw Honor Guard will conduct military honors at the cemetery. Family and friends may call at the Allen Chapel from Thursday morning until service time.

Mr. Doyle died Tuesday, March 29, 2005, at his home. He was born Feb. 19, 1938, at Holdenville, Okla., to Jack and Wilma Eubanks Doyle.

He lived in the Allen area all his life. He attended school at Panther Creek and graduated from Gerty High School.

He married Pat Dunn on Jan. 3, 1992, at Fort Smith, Ark.

Mr. Doyle was a truck driver and also was employed with the oil and gas production industry. He served in the U. S. Navy.

Survivors include his wife, Pat Doyle, of the home; brother, Truman Doyle, Winnemucca, Nev.; a sister, Doris Jean Hopkins, Cartersville, Ga.; step-daughter, Donna Nelson, Barnsdall; a step-granddaughter, Jocelyn Nelson; and several nieces, nephews and cousins.

He was preceded in death by his parents, Jack and Wilma Doyle, and a son, Brian Doyle in 1994 in Arkansas.

Bearers will be Bruce Merriman, Roger Merriman, Chris Merriman, Morris Chiles, Tommy McFerran and Sonny Wallace. Honorary bearer will be Leonard Iker.

Criswell Funeral Home, Ada

JOHNNY WOODS JR.
ASHER — Services for Johnny “Jay” Lee Woods Jr., 27, Asher, are 2 p.m. Thursday at Pentecostal Holiness Church, Oil Center, the Rev. Farron Oliver officiating. Burial follows at Maxwell Cemetery.

Mr. Woods died March 27, 2005, at Asher. He was born Dec. 12, 1977, in Oklahoma City to Johnny Lee Woods Sr. and Angela Witt Woods.

He was a diesel mechanic and lived in the Byars, Konawa and Asher areas most of his life.

He and Lisa Kile were married July 12, 2003, at Oklahoma City.

He was preceded in death by his grandfathers, Bud Witt and Bill Woods.

Survivors include his wife, Lisa Woods, Asher; a son, Takoda Lynn Ray, Asher; a daughter, Taylor Nicole Ray, Asher; his parents, Angela and Danny Strawn, Oil Center, Johnny Lee Woods Sr. and Vicki Woods, Prague; four brothers, Mickey Woods and Jachin Woods, both of Prague, Nathan Strawn, Christian Strawn, both of Oil Center; a sister, Ashlee Strawn, Oil Center; grandparents, A.J. and Juanita Moore, Konawa, and Jewell Woods, Midwest City.

Pickard Funeral Home, Stratford

JAMES PARK
SASAKWA — Services for James Clarence Park, 79, Sasakwa, are 10 a.m. Wednesday at Criswell Funeral Home Chapel, the Rev. Mickey Keith will officiate. Burial will follow at Swan Hill Cemetery in Ada.

Mr. Park died Monday, March 28, 2005, at his home. He was born Aug. 11, 1925, in Kingston to James W. and Reola Minton Park. He attended school at McCall’s Chapel School, graduated from Allen High School and attended East Central University.

Mr. Park married Loretta “Rita” Ballard in June 1947 in Ada. He was an accountant and a special agent for the Internal Revenue Service. Mr. Park was a member of the Evangelistic Temple and a state director for Prison Fellowship. He also served in the U.S. Navy for four years as a torpedoman’s mate, second class.

Survivors include his wife, Rita Park, of the home; daughter, Jan Park, Stonewall; son, Jim Park and wife Anita, Mena, Ark.; brother, Gene Park and wife Beth, Pearsall, Texas; two sisters, Edna Mae Davis, Sealy, Texas, and Joanne Fasler and husband Elmer, Yancey, Texas; seven grandchildren; and 10 great-grandchildren.

Bearers will be Jim Park, Wayne Park, Ronny Blaylock, Kevin Yandell, Cecil O’Neal and Donny Blackburn.

Honorary bearers are James E. Park, Jeffery Park and Jason Park.

Criswell Funeral Home, Ada
